Essential Elements of Growing Tent with Lights

Growing tents are enclosed structures made from durable materials like Mylar or reflective fabric that create an isolated growing space. They come in various sizes and shapes to accommodate different plant sizes and quantities.

Grow lights are the lifeblood of growing tent with lights. They provide the necessary spectrum of light that plants need for photosynthesis. From traditional fluorescent tubes to modern LED panels, various types of grow lights offer specific benefits and cater to different budgets.

Type of Grow Light Benefits Drawbacks
Fluorescent Tubes Affordable Limited light intensity
HID (High-Intensity Discharge) High-intensity, penetrating light Energy-intensive, heat-prone
LED (Light-Emitting Diode) Energy-efficient, long-lasting, full spectrum Higher upfront cost
Tent Size Plant Capacity Suitable for
2' x 2' 1-2 small plants Seedlings, cuttings
4' x 4' 4-6 medium plants Vegetative growth, flowering
6' x 6' 8-12 large plants Full-cycle growth

Benefits of Growing Tent with Lights

  • Controlled Environment: Regulate light exposure, temperature, and humidity to maximize plant growth.
  • Pest and Disease Protection: Shield plants from external pests and diseases by creating a closed environment.
  • Increased Yield: Optimize lighting and environmental conditions to boost yields by up to 30%.
  • Year-Round Growing: Grow plants indoors regardless of season, allowing for continuous harvests.
  • Space Optimization: Utilize vertical space by using trellises and suspending plants, maximizing plant count in limited areas.
